Output 3d59cd375f7f7ae1dc95106737a3ac58bce04b5ddfbbb52aa7db1141ea167e9e:0

value
26000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 b476608ed242b7acbc3e048471a213546472a101 OP_EQUALVERIFY OP_CHECKSIG
address
1HTCSXAZxxZ1FFVFzbQ2fP6RJskrvGhRP4
transaction
3d59cd375f7f7ae1dc95106737a3ac58bce04b5ddfbbb52aa7db1141ea167e9e
confirmations
427720
spent
true